3. Irreplaceable Photos Handled with the Utmost Care
Older prints and negatives are often fragile. Handling them incorrectly can lead to irreversible damage; this is something we see all too often when people attempt DIY scanning.
At Mr Scan, we treat every single item with archival care:
- Wearing gloves to prevent oils from hands transferring to the image.
- Using non-abrasive cleaning methods to remove dust and debris before scanning.
- Ensuring each item is kept in order, so your collection stays organised.
We’ve handled everything from century-old prints to delicate 8mm cinefilm. We know how to get them safely from physical form to digital format without harm.

5. Save Yourself Hours of Time
Digitising a large photo collection at home is incredibly time-consuming. You’ll need to manually scan each image and then crop, rotate, and adjust it. It involves backing everything up. If you have hundreds, or thousands, of photos, this can take weeks or even months!
